General
Well 6407/7-4 was drilled on the Njord A-East structure in the southern part of the Halten Terrace. The Njord structure is located ca 30 km west of the Draugen Field. The location was within a gentle ice berg plough mark with a trend southwest-northeast. The primary objective was to establish the oil-water contact in the Tilje Formation. Secondary objectives were to obtain a better mapping of the reservoir quality of the Tilje Formation on the east flank, to test productivity and injectivity of the Tilje Formation, and to appraise the down flank oil bearing potential and productivity of the Ile Formation. Reservoir fluids including formation water should be sampled. Boulders were expected at 395 m, and shallow gas from 509 - 528 m and especially at 553 m.
Operations and results
Appraisal well 6407/7-4 was spudded by the semi-submersible rig Polar Pioneer on 11 January 1989 drilled to TD at 3211 m in Early Jurassic sediments of the Åre Formation. Spudding was delayed due to severe weather conditions causing the rig to drift 43 nautical miles off location. No shallow gas was encountered. Further periods of bad weather led to some problems and WOW, but apart from this the drilling proceeded without significant problems. The well was drilled with spud mud down to 538 m and with KCl mud from 538 m to TD.
